We’re looking for a driven and compassionate ABA Clinical Recruiter to join our growing team! In this role, you’ll be the bridge between mission-driven professionals and the children who need them most—recruiting top-tier talent for ABA therapy roles (BCBAs, BCaBAs, RBTs), as well as Occupational Therapists and Speech-Language Pathologists across Michigan.
What You’ll Do:
- Lead full-cycle recruitment efforts for clinical positions: source, screen, interview, and coordinate hiring of qualified candidates
- Collaborate with clinical leadership and HR to understand hiring needs and forecast future staffing demands
- Use creative sourcing strategies to attract highly qualified candidates, including social media, job boards, networking, referral programs, and community outreach
- Build and nurture a pipeline of passionate clinicians and maintain relationships with schools, universities, and professional organizations
- Ensure a seamless and positive candidate experience from first contact through onboarding
- Track and report on recruitment metrics, identify trends, and recommend improvements to hiring strategies
- Promote our mission and culture to prospective candidates in an authentic and compelling way
